Agent, you forgot the old fashioned way!
Best thing to do if it's a tech post is to upload them directly to r3v (informational threads/posts). Sorry, no time for screenshots and paint, but if you hit the "go advanced" button in the reply box, it will take you to another screen with more options.
At the top of the reply box, you will see a paperclip icon. Hit that and it will allow you to upload pic(s) via a popup. Once they load, close the popup window, then hit the paperclip icon again and you will have options to choose which pic(s) you want to post.
